gpt4 book ai didi

PHP PDO 用户名可用性检查器

转载 作者:行者123 更新时间:2023-11-29 05:33:34 25 4
gpt4 key购买 nike

<分区>

我正在构建一个注册页面,该页面使用 JQuery 的验证器插件来验证表单。对于用户名,我使用了 remote方法。所以这是我的 jquery+html 代码:fiddle

这里是 Available.php:

<?php 
$usr = $_POST['username'];
$link = new PDO('mysql:host=***;dbname=***;charset=UTF-8','***','***');
$usr_check = $link->prepare("SELECT * FROM Conference WHERE Username = :usr");
$usr_check->bindParam(':usr', $usr);
$usr_check->execute();
if($usr_check->rowCount()>0)
echo false;
else
echo true;
?>

所以我的数据库中有一个测试帐户,用户名为:user。当我尝试使用相同的用户名提交我的表单时,它没有显示“用户名已被占用”的错误,这意味着 php 不正确。我哪里出错了?谢谢

编辑:在 chrome 的检查器打开的情况下运行网站。输入用户名时,它会尝试获取 Available.php,但会显示“500 内部服务器错误”。这是它的样子: 500 Error

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com